What is the least expensive restaurant franchise?
Despite its success, Chick-fil-A charges franchisees only $10,000 to open a new restaurant, and it doesn’t require candidates meet a threshold for net worth or liquid assets, the company told Business Insider. That’s cheaper than every major fast-food chain in the U.S.

How much to own a Chick-fil-A?
Opening a Chick-fil-A franchise costs between $342,990 and $1,982,225, including a $10,000 franchise fee, but unlike most other franchisors, Chick-fil-A covers all opening expenses, meaning franchisees are on the hook only for that $10,000.
What is McDonald’s franchise fee?
How much is a McDonald’s Franchise? The total investment necessary to begin operation of a traditional McDonald’s franchise ranges from $1,008,000 to $2,214,080. This includes an initial franchise fee of $45,000.00 that must be paid to the franchisor.
How much does it cost to open a Steak n Shake franchise?
The estimated investment required to open a Steak n Shake Franchise is between $672,000-$1,835,000. There is an initial franchise fee of $25,000-$40,000 which grants you the license to run a business under the Steak n Shake name.
What is Starbucks franchise fee?
You’ll need to pay an initial fee of somewhere between $40,000 and $90,000, and have a net worth of at least $250,000, with at least $125,000 of that liquid and ready to pour into the business. After all is said and done, you should expect to pay somewhere between $228,620 and $1,691,200, just to get the doors open.

How much does a Chick-fil-A franchise make?
The average Chick-fil-A restaurant produces $5.3 million in gross annual sales. This is astonishing, seeing as close competitor Popeye’s averages $1.5 million per franchise location, and quick-service restaurant (QSR) industry leader McDonald’s averages $2.7 million.

Can you get a bank loan to open a franchise?
Traditional Loans
You can arrange to borrow from ordinary commercial banks or credit unions for your new venture. According to the Small Business Administration (SBA), new franchise owners have a higher tendency to borrow from commercial banks than new business owners.

How do I start a franchise with no money?
It’s not possible to start a franchise without any money. You’ll need to pay an initial franchise fee, and you will have other start-up costs. Furthermore, franchisors want to see that you have some skin in the game in the form of a down payment.
